Goodreads Synopsis: Amelie has always been a survivor, from losing her parents as a child in Paris to making it on her own in London. As she builds a life for herself, she is swept up into a glamorous lifestyle where she married the handsome billionaire Ned Hawthorne. But then, Amelie wakes up in a pitch-black room, not knowing where she is. Why has she been taken? Who are her mysterious captors? And why does she soon feel safer here, imprisoned, than she had begun to feel with her husband Ned? https://www.goodreads.com/book/show/59808228-the-prisoner Thank you to B.A. Paris and NetGalley for providing me with an ebook copy of The Prisoner for me to read and review. Wow! B.A. Paris did it again! What an awesome, captivating, addictive read! I was immediately hooked with the way the story jumped right into the thick of the action and then gave us little bits of background and depth through the multiple timelines portrayed in part 1. I loved the way Paris wrote the main character with such description and depth. It allowed me to really feel connected to her and sympathize with her situation. And what a plot! The twists and turns were wild enough to give me whiplash and I didn't know who could be trusted. It took me on a wild ride of emotions, uncertainty, and fear and left me aching for a sequel. Definitely a must-read! 5 Stars!

Goodreads Synopsis: Jada Scott has chosen to fill a rather unique position at Dual Construction. One minute she's in the courtroom examining the witness and the next... well let's just say she's the one being examined. Regardless, Jada is willing to put it all on the line to work for Ashton Kent. A gorgeous CEO that brings new meaning to the saying a closed mouth doesn't get fed. https://www.goodreads.com/book/show/62884225-his-mouth-piece Thank you to Nicki Grace for providing me with an ebook copy of His Mouth Piece for me to read and review. What a wild ride of spicy scenarios. Pun intended. Grace's novel is filled with spicy sexual content, but balanced with a unique and interesting plot. The dominant and submissive roles was a huge part of the characters' relationship and I loved that Grace was able to portray the female main character as such a strong, confident, independent woman while still enjoying that submissive role. Erin is used to being friend-zoned. Erin’s always been one of the guys, and she’s fine with that. After suddenly losing her sports career to an injury, she has much more important things to focus on. Even if subbing for her best friend as a secretary has her working closely with her sexy as sin boss. The too proper man could never be interested in someone like her, despite one night together that completely changes her opinion on sex. Nicholas always has to be in charge. There’s no way that a spur-of-the-moment, says-every-thought-in-her-head woman could fit into Nicholas’s world, so why can’t he get Erin out of his thoughts? When he takes her to a ritzy event, he expects it to be a disaster. Instead he has fun, which has never been a part of his life. When her injury flares, he proposes a fake marriage, with added benefits besides insurance. Having her around will drive his father to distraction while Nicholas finishes what must be done. Plus he’ll get to keep her close for a little longer. Neither expect the sparks they feel to flame into much more. Now Nicholas must convince her he has nothing to offer before he proves he’s just like his father. He can’t risk her light being dimmed by the past he’ll never be able to leave behind. Thank you to Amber Warden and BookSirens for providing me with an ebook copy of Finding Instinct for me to read and review. Holy hot, hot, hot! This was the perfect balance between plot and spice. The characters were such interesting people with extremely unique pasts. I would have enjoyed learning a bit more details about their pasts but they developed so much throughout the story that I was really rooting for them to successfully overcome their challenges and roadblocks. And the chemistry was volcanic! This is book 3 in the Long Shot Tavern series and while it can be read on its own, having the prior knowledge from the previous books definitely added to the depth of the story. I can't wait to see what happens in the next book. 4 Stars! |
